Roddy Piper’s Daughter Says She’s Honored By Ronda Rousey Wearing His Jacket
Image Credit: WWE
– Roddy Piper’s daughter says that she feels honored by Ronda Rousey wearing her father’s jacket when she came out during the Royal Rumble. Ariel Teal Toombs spoke with TMZ about Rousey’s appearance at the Rumble, where she wore a T-Shirt inspired by Piper and wore his jacket.
“Honestly, I feel honored,” Toombs said (per Wrestling Inc). “It’s so empowering to see a woman like Ronda, like, coming into wrestling right now. And then, on top of it, her wearing his jacket, that symbolism is very sweet. She’s just so great about carrying the torch and showing her Piper pride.”
She also said that Rousey is continuing Piper’s legacy, saying, “The beauty of Ronda is that she’s bringing in her own fanbase. So she has a whole lot of fans that maybe weren’t even Piper fans that she’ll be bringing her own element to. There’ll never be another ‘Rowdy’ Roddy Piper. There just won’t. We can all pay tribute to him and do our best, but I think that Ronda is gonna do a great job taking the talent and the fighting charisma she has, and becoming her own new thing. And I think this is just her paying tribute because dad was so much a part of her life.”
